The autoplay feature in Microsoft
Windows
98 interferes with the operation of the computer's power management time-outs. If Dell installed
Windows 98 on your hard-disk drive, the autoplay feature was disabled. If you enable autoplay, or if you installed Windows 98 yourself, Dell
recommends that you disable autoplay.
See your Windows 98 documentation for instructions on changing the Auto Insert Notification option.
 diskette drive
The diskette drive is a removable-storage device which comes as a combination module with a CD-ROM drive or DVD-ROM drive in the
computer's media bay. The diskette drive lets you install programs and transfer data using 3.5-inch diskettes.

 display adapter
The logical circuitry that provides—in combination with the display or monitor—your computer's video capabilities. A display adapter may support
more or fewer features than a specific display or monitor offers. Typically, a display adapter comes with video drivers for displaying popular
application programs and operating environments in a variety of video modes. On Dell portable computers, a display adapter is integrated into the
system board.
Display adapters often include memory separate from RAM on the system board. The amount of video memory, along with the adapter's video
drivers, may affect the number of colors or shades of gray that can be simultaneously displayed. Display adapters can also include their own
coprocessor for faster graphics rendering.
 DMA
Abbreviation for direct memory access. A DMA channel allows certain types of data transfer between RAM and a device to bypass the
microprocessor.

 DPMS
®
Abbreviation for Display Power Management Signaling. A standard developed by VESA
that defines the hardware signals sent by a video
controller to activate power management states in a monitor. A monitor is said to be DPMS-compliant when it is designed to enter a power
management state after receiving the appropriate signal from a computer's video controller.
 DRAM
Abbreviation for dynamic random-access memory. A computer's RAM is usually made up entirely of DRAM chips. Because DRAM chips cannot
store an electrical charge indefinitely, your computer continually refreshes each DRAM chip in the computer.

 DTE
Abbreviation for data terminal equipment. Any device, such as a computer system, that can send data in digital form by means of a cable or
communications line. The DTE is connected to the cable or communications line through a data communications equipment (DCE) device, such
as a modem.
 DVD
Abbreviation for digital versatile disc. A large-capacity optical disc able to store more data than standard CDs.
